Most Yearly Snow in Cornelia History

This is a list of the largest annual snowfall totals ever recorded in Cornelia, Georgia history from 1919–2024. If you are looking for the most snow in a winter season, click here.
What Was the Snowiest Year in Cornelia History?
According to NOAA records, the most snow that Cornelia, Georgia has ever received in a single calendar year is 17.6 inches which occurred in 1936.
